Diana L. Williams (she/her)
Kravis Professor of Integrated Sciences: Neuroscience

Background & Education: Diana was a first-generation student at Brooklyn College, City University of New York, where she she received her BA in Psychology in 1998. She attended University of Pennsylvania for her PhD in Psychology, concentrating in Behavioral Neuroscience (2003). Next came a postdoctoral fellowship at the University of Washington School of Medicine. In 2008, she joined the faculty in the Psychology Department and Program in Neuroscience at Florida State University, where she was a professor for 16 years. She moved to Claremont McKenna College in 2024 and started her new lab at the Robert Day Sciences Center in Fall 2025.
